While playing a Cap expert on HB i noticed CF does the work for you and puts the cap % in the contract details
https://www.capfriendly.com/players/alex-ovechkin
SIGNING DATE: January 10, 2008 - 16.82%
but ya, Matthews is 14.63% - senstroll
I don't like the way Cap Friendly calculates cap percentage. It bases it on the current year's salary cap even though that salary will not be paid out until the new cap is established. The negotiations, I would expect, are very much based off of cap projections and cap percentages.
If you sign after June xx when the new cap number is released, then the cap number is based on the adjusted cap value. So it's not always comparing apples to apples. |
